| FORM 990, PART III, LINE 3 | NEW 'FLASH WORKSHOPS', PODCASTS, AND ONLINE SERVICE DELIVERIES WERE INTEGRATED IN 2020 AS A RESULT OF THE COVID-19 PANDEMIC. |
| FORM 990, PART III, LINE 4A, DESCRIPTION OF PROGRAM SERVICE: | SCIENTIFIC RESEARCH, WORKSHOPS AND EDUCATIONAL ENDEAVORS ON VARIOUS RESEARCH TOPICS. RESEARCH IS UNDERTAKEN FOR THE PUBLIC INTEREST AND IS NOT INTENDED FOR THE PRIMARY BENEFIT OF A PRIVATE PERSON OR ORGANIZATION. PEOPLE ARE SFI'S FOUNDATION: SFI MAINTAINED 12 RESIDENT FACULTY, 15 POST-DOCTORAL RESEARCHERS, AND ADDED ANOTHER 13 NEW EXTERNAL FACULTY DURING THE PANDEMIC DESPITE RESTRICTIONS IN PLACE ON IN PERSON MEETINGS AND WORKSHOPS/WORKING GROUPS. DESPITE THE PANDEMIC, SFI HAS MANAGED TO HOST 213 IN PERSON VISITORS, ALONG WITH 39 MEETINGS, 78 SEMINARS, 24 POST-DOCTORAL VIRTUAL SESSIONS, AND 100'S OF UNIQUE VIRTUAL PARTICIPANTS ACROSS MULTIPLE EVENTS. SFI RECEIVED AN ADDITIONAL 13 FEDERAL, FOUNDATION, AND INTERNATIONAL GRANTS IN 2020. 36 PODCASTS LED BY DAVID KRAKAUER, THE TRANSMISSION SERIES, WERE CONDUCTED IN 2020, ALONG WITH A NEW CATEGORY OF 'FLASH WORKSHOPS' RELATED TO COVID-19, CONDUCTED BY VARIOUS SFI FACULTY AND RESEARCHERS. 2020 ALSO WITNESSED THE OPENING OF THE NEW MILLER CAMPUS IN TESUQUE, NM, AS WELL AS THE OPENING OF A NEW 'POD' HOUSING FACULTY AT THE EXISTING COWAN CAMPUS. |

| FORM 990, PART VI, SECTION B, LINE 12C | EMPLOYEES, MANAGEMENT, AND BOARD MEMBERS ARE SUBJECT TO THE CONFLICT OF INTEREST POLICY. EMPLOYEES AND MANAGEMENT ATTEST TO THEIR INDEPENDENCE WHEN HIRED AND ARE REQUIRED TO INFORM THE ORGANIZATION SHOULD THEIR SITUATION CHANGE. BOARD MEMBERS RECEIVE THE CONFLICT OF INTEREST POLICY UPON APPOINTMENT AND ARE REQUIRED TO ATTEST TO THEIR INDEPENDENCE ANNUALLY. CONFLICT DETERMINATIONS ARE MADE AND REVIEWED BY MANAGEMENT OR THE CHAIR OF THE BOARD OF TRUSTEES, AS APPROPRIATE. A CONFLICTED INDIVIDUAL IS PROHIBITED FROM PARTICIPATING IN DELIBERATIONS AND DECISIONS CONCERNING THE SUBJECT TRANSACTION. |
| FORM 990, PART VI, SECTION B, LINE 15A | THE PRESIDENT'S COMPENSATION IS DETERMINED BY A LETTER AGREEMENT NEGOTIATED BY THE TRUSTEES. IN NEGOTIATING THE AGREEMENT, THE TRUSTEES USE COMPARABILITY DATA FROM VARIOUS ACADEMIC INSTITUTIONS AND OTHER RELEVANT PERIODICALS AND STUDIES. ANNUALLY, THE TRUSTEES EVALUATE THE PRESIDENT'S PERFORMANCE IN THE COMPENSATION REVIEW. THESE ACTIONS ARE DOCUMENTED IN THE MINUTES OF THE MEETINGS. THE PROCESS OF EVALUATING COMPARABLE DATA WAS LAST DONE IN 2020. THE COMPENSATION PROCESS FOR OTHER OFFICERS, INCLUDING: VICE PRESIDENTS AND BOARD SECRETARY, IS DETERMINED BY THE PRESIDENT USING COMPARABILITY DATA FROM SIMILAR ACADEMIC INSTITUTIONS AND OTHER RELEVANT PERIODICALS AND STUDIES, AS APPROPRIATE. THIS PROCESS WAS LAST COMPLETED IN 2020. |

| SCHEDULE L, PART II: | EFFECTIVE AUGUST 1, 2015, THE INSTITUTE PROVIDED THE PRESIDENT WITH THREE LOANS, EACH OF WHICH IS DOCUMENTED BY A PROMISSORY NOTE PRESCRIBING INTEREST COMPOUNDED ANNUALLY (AT THE THEN APPLICABLE FEDERAL RATE OF 1.77%), REPAYMENT SCHEDULE, AND CONSEQUENCES OF DEFAULT, AMONG OTHER TERMS. PRINCIPAL AND INTEREST UNDER THESE NOTES IS DUE FIVE YEARS FROM THE EFFECTIVE DATE. THE INSTITUTE AMENDED THE TERMS OF THIS AGREEMENT ON JUNE 24, 2019 TO EXTEND THE TERM BEYOND AUGUST 1, 2020. FURTHERMORE, A FINAL AMENDMENT TO THE PROMISSORY NOTE WAS EXECUTED DECEMBER 19, 2020, WHEREIN THE INSTITUTE MODIFIED THE ORIGINAL MATURITY OF THESE LOANS AS FOLLOWS: THE FIRST OF THESE LOANS, IN THE AMOUNT OF $100,000, WAS FULLY FORGIVEN JULY 31, 2020. THE SECOND OF THESE LOANS, IN THE AMOUNT OF $100,000, WILL BE FORGIVEN IN THE EVENT THE INSTITUTE'S PERPETUAL ENDOWMENT INVESTMENT POOL INCREASES BY AT LEAST TWENTY MILLION DOLLARS. PER THE FINAL AMENDMENT, THIS TERM HAS BEEN MET BASED ON THE DETERMINATION OF THE BOARD OF TRUSTEES, AND WILL BE FORGIVEN EFFECTIVE AUGUST 1, 2021. THE THIRD LOAN , IN THE AMOUNT OF $100,000, IS TO BE FORGIVEN AS OF AUGUST 1, 2022. THE AMOUNT OF PRINCIPAL AND INTEREST FORGIVEN WAS $109,168 DURING 2020 AND IS FULLY REPORTED IN PART VII OF FORM 990 AND IN PART II OF SCHEDULE J. |
